Как очистить кэш Ruby Phusion Passenger в Ubuntu? - PullRequest
5 голосов
/ 23 сентября 2008

Я попытался перезапустить apache, и кэшированные страницы все еще появляются, поэтому где-то должна быть папка. У меня нет 'public / cache', так какие еще места мне искать? Есть ли флаг URL, который также может вызвать этот эффект?

Ответы [ 5 ]

9 голосов
/ 23 сентября 2008

Вам нужно дотронуться до файла, чтобы очистить фразу, например:

touch /webapps/mycook/tmp/restart.txt

См. документы

1 голос
/ 23 сентября 2008

Я в режиме разработки.

Я обнаружил, что мне нужно перезапустить службу apache и очистить кеш браузера, чтобы мои изменения появлялись в 100% случаев.

0 голосов
/ 19 января 2018

Для тех, кто приезжает сюда в наше время

Теперь есть больше возможностей для перезапуска passanger из ssh. Вот обновленный документ

passenger-config restart-app

или

passenger-config restart-app /Users/phusion/testapp

и старый способ, который можно сделать, если у вас был только FTP-доступ

touch tmp/restart.txt

это будет сделано не сразу, passanger будет искать измененную временную метку, которая будет изменена для выполнения перезапуска.

0 голосов
/ 23 сентября 2008

Ctrl + F5 принудительно перезагрузит страницу и все связанные с ней ресурсы.

Это похоже на очистку кэша только для одной страницы.

0 голосов
/ 23 сентября 2008

Во-первых, вы очистили кеш браузера? Вы можете сделать это через меню браузера, где-нибудь в настройках.

Следующий вопрос, который я хотел бы задать: вы запускаете приложение в режиме производства или разработки?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...